Output ece1fa3889f7c2feec92e3c865cdb77f60dd8d83d81eaab3e75879c5694a7dbe:0

value
759542
script pubkey
OP_0 OP_PUSHBYTES_20 634a31803f0248fff65075bb66c86bca30907550
address
bc1qvd9rrqplqfy0lajswkakdjrtegcfqa2s9zhque
transaction
ece1fa3889f7c2feec92e3c865cdb77f60dd8d83d81eaab3e75879c5694a7dbe
confirmations
89800
spent
true